5 FAQs about [Gibraltar Solar Power]

Who are Gibraltar's solar companies?

Gibraltar's renewables division includes SolarBOS, an electrical balance of system solutions provider, TerraSmart, and Sunfig. SolarBOS was added in 2018, while TerraSmart was acquired this year. TerraSmart is a solar foundations manufacturer that offers turnkey installation and civil services.

Does Gibraltar have electricity?

Until recently, Gibraltar’s electricity supply was dependent on some 40 diesel‑powered engines and turbines distributed across Gibraltar. In 2019 a new, modern power station situated at the North Mole commenced operation running long term on liquid natural gas (LNG).

How long will Eco Wave Power last in Gibraltar?

According to the agreement between Eco Wave Power and the Government of Gibraltar, the pilot was built and originally supposed to operate only for two years, with the purpose of proving that wave energy can safely connect to the grid and withstand the Gibraltar storms, using its storm-protection mechanism.

Who owns RBI Solar?

RBI Solar is owned by Gibraltar Industries. Gibraltar Industries acquired RBI Solar in 2015. Gibraltar also owns SolarBOS, an electrical balance of system solutions provider, which it added to its renewables division in 2018. This year, Gibraltar acquired TerraSmart and Sunfig.
